CVE-2020-4044 describes a buffer overflow vulnerability in the xrdp-sesman service, affecting neutrinolabs xrdp versions prior to 0.9.13.1. An unprivileged attacker can crash the sesman service by sending a malicious payload to port 3350, then launch an imposter service to capture user credentials and potentially hijack existing xorgxrdp sessions. This vulnerability has a CVSS score of 7.8 (High), indicating high imp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ability, with low attack complexity and requiring local privileges. There is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code (Metasploit, Nuclei, ExploitDB), or significant community discussion surrounding this CVE.
